WebJan 30, 2024 · Vitamin D Dose and Blood Levels. A dose of 1,000 IU (25 mcg) of vitamin D3 per day will help 50% of people to maintain a vitamin D blood level of 33 ng/ml (82.4 nmol/L). Whereas a dose of 2,000 IU (50 mcg) per day will help almost everyone to maintain a blood level of 33 ng/ml (82.4 nmol/L). (1) This is the dose found in a high quality vitamin ... WebJul 31, 2024 · Today, many countries still use the IU to measure vitamin D; 1 IU of vitamin D is equivalent to 0.025 micrograms (abbreviated as either mcg or μg) of cholecalciferol or ergocalciferol.1 Conversely, 1 microgram of vitamin D equals 40 IU of vitamin D.
